Medical Conditions - Mediterranean Diet

Mediterranean diet is a diet rich in fruits, vegetables, grains, cereals, nuts, fish, and unsaturated fat. This diet restricts the use of refined oils, refined grains, pastries, processed meat, sugars, sodas, etc. They help in improving sugar levels, maintain cardiac health, etc.
